Nmap scan mysql vulnerability. Target: The IP address or domain name of the target.
Nmap scan mysql vulnerability. 1 . First thing I needed was a vulnerable host to scan. E. 12 and 5. ; cpe but NO version: vulnerabilities that affect every version of the product. Fortunately, we can use Nmap to scan a web server looking for SQL injection vulnerabilities quickly. 1(or) host name. nse script attempts to bypass authentication in MySQL and MariaDB servers by exploiting CVE2012-2122. I'm curious if an attacker can derive . For that, you need to use user defined functions. Real Deal Holyfield. If its vulnerable, it will also attempt to dump the The powerful open-source tool Nmap scans the ports of network devices and probes website domains for known vulnerabilities. Examples include CSRF detection, Shellshock exploitation, and checks for Slowloris DoS vulnerabilities. This is our 3rd course in our Ethical Hacking series Whether you want to get your first job in IT security, become a white hat hacker, or prepare to check the security of Reporting vulnerability checks performed during a scan Nmap can be turned into a vulnerability scanner by using NSE scripts. Fortunately, we can use Nmap to quickly scan a web Another option is to use a custom Nmap database support patch. Nmap @ https://nmap. It does this by searching for something called a CVE, which stands for common vulnerabilities and exposures. Skip to main content. EternalBlue). Reply reply Horfire • The Nmap is very popular tool for security engineers. It is an essential tool in the early stages of security assessments, even though it is not a vulnerability scanner. September 21, 2017 by Raj. Let’s look at how to set up this tool as well as how to run a basic CVE scan. For example, “nmap” scans IPv4 addresses by default but can also scan IPv6 addresses if the proper option is specified (nmap -6). Skip to content . Scan multiple network/targets. ”When we analyzed the top vulnerability scanning tools available, Nmap wasn’t mentioned among them; it isn’t To sum up, Nmap is a very strong network research tool that excels in network reconnaissance and discovery. Besides introducing the most powerful features of Nmap and related tools, common security auditing tasks for local and remote networks, web Welcome to the "Ethical Hacking: Network Scan Nmap& Nessus| Network Security" course Scan networks with vulnerabilities by using Nmap& Nessus Master Cyber Security, ethical hacking, network hacking skills. The data is looked up in an offline version of VulDB. For example, noting that the version of PHP disclosed in the screenshot is version 5. The malicious library to use can be found inside sqlmap and inside metasploit by doing locate "*lib_mysqludf_sys*". Discover the most useful nmap scanning, enumeration, and evasion commands with our comprehensive Nmap cheat sheet and take your hacking to the next level. Attempts to bypass authentication in MySQL and MariaDB servers byexploiting CVE2012-2122. vulscan - Vulnerability Scanning with Nmap. This type of web vulnerability is very common, and because each script variable must be tested, checking for such vulnerabilities can be a very tedious task. 0 Keep in mind that this kind of derivative vulnerability scanning heavily relies on the confidence of the version detection of nmap, the amount of documented vulnerabilities and the accuracy of pattern matching. Script Summary. Vulscan is an open-source vulnerability scanner addon for Nmap that allows comprehensive vulnerability management. Nmap, a powerful network scanning tool, can be used in conjunction with the Nmap Scripting Engine (NSE) to detect NOTE: Unlike previous versions, this script will NOT attempt to log in to SQL Server instances. Forensic Investigation of Nmap Scan using Wireshark. Spiders an HTTP server looking for URLs containing queries vulnerable to an SQL injection attack. Options: Additional options such as port range or timing options. , TCP, SYN). If service detection is performed and the MySQL Penetration Testing with Nmap. Stack Exchange Network. silent_require "openssl" description = [[ Performs valid-user enumeration against MySQL server using a bug discovered and This type of web vulnerability is widespread, and because each script variable must be tested, checking for such vulnerabilities can be a very tedious task. By leveraging Nmap's port scanning and service/version detection capabilities, you can identify potential vulnerabilities on target systems. The outcome of this tutorial will be to gather information on a host and its running services and their versions and vulnerabilities, rather than to exploit an unpatched service. Step-by-Step Guide to Installing and Using Nmap for Heartbleed This video will demonstrate how to use Nmap NSE http-sql-injection script to perform sqli injection scans on a http website. Depending on the size of the network and the number of active devices, the scan may take several minutes to finish. Target: The IP address or domain name of the target. Visit Stack Exchange. Top 20 Microsoft Azure Vulnerabilities and Misconfigurations; CMS Vulnerability Scanners for WordPress, Joomla, Drupal, Moodle, Typo3. Installation The current implementation take care of the following cases: If Nmap detects: cpe AND version: vulnerabilities affecting version and vulnerabilities affecting a range of versions that include version. In Nmap you can even scan multiple targets for host discovery/information Vulnerability Assessment Menu Toggle. One example is nmap-sql, which adds MySQL logging functionality into Nmap itself. . k. This recipe shows how to find SQL injection vulnerabilities in web applications with . Once the Nmap scan is complete, you will see the output displaying the discovered hosts and their open ports, running services, and other relevant Similar to MSSQL, this tool is used to scan MySQL servers for vulnerabilities. SQL injection vulnerabilities are caused by the lack of sanitation of user input, and they allow attackers to execute DBMS queries that could compromise the entire system. Once the scan is complete, NMAP will generate a report detailing the open ports, operating system Run a web app scan to test your website code for misconfigured cookies, SQL injection vulnerabilities, cross-site scripting vulnerabilities, and more. Nmap scan forensics tool using Wireshark to analyze network traffic. nse) vulnerability scripts for the TCP/UDP services. NMAP is a powerful network scanner that can be used to find vulnerabilities such as heartbleed. Download: https://svn. Nikto is a web server scanner specialized in identifying Uses ChatGPT API, Bard API, and Llama2, Python-Nmap, DNS Recon, PCAP and JWT recon modules and uses the GPT3 model to create vulnerability reports based on Nmap scan data, and DNS scan information. It's typically recommended to Vulscan is a module which enhances nmap to a vulnerability scanner. msf 5> db_nmap -sV -A -p Individual Vulnerability Scanning: Nmap provides the ability to perform targeted scans for specific vulnerabilities using individual scripts. In this expert guide, we will deep dive into Vulscan – covering installation, This kind of scans, such as the Nmap scan host are perfect for your first steps when starting with Nmap. One of the primary use cases for Nmap in cybersecurity is vulnerability scanning. NMAP will start scanning the network and provide you with real-time feedback on the scan progress. - Mukaramp77/Nmap-Vulnerability-Scanner Comprehensive Guide on Nmap Port Status; How to Detect NMAP Scan Using Snort; Understanding Guide to Nmap Firewall Scan (Part 2) Understanding Guide to Nmap Firewall Scan (Part 1) Understanding Nmap Scan with Wireshark; Password Cracking using Nmap; Vulnerability Scan; Network Scanning using NMAP (Beginner Guide) MSSQL Penetration NMAP has been around for years. The The mysql-vuln-cve2012-2122. Nmap is widely used for network mapping and security auditing. x If the mysql server is running as root (or a different more privileged user) you can make it execute commands. ; cpe AND version range: vulnerabilities affecting versions between version range (included). A recently disclosed critical vulnerability in MySQL authentication on some platforms gave me just the excuse I needed to write my first Nmap NSE script. It integrates with Nmap to allow identifying vulnerabilities associated with network services detected during port scanning and service enumeration. HostedScan Security provides a comprehensive set MySQL is an open-source Relational Database Management System (RDBMS). TLS Security Scan . This is quite different from my Nmap is widely known for its famous port mapping capabilities — we love it, and even included it in our best port scanners article a few months ago. Lets start by scanning the port: > db_nmap -sV -p 3306 192. 2. You can easily use those approaches [] Leveraging Nmap for Cybersecurity Vulnerability Scanning with Nmap. g. HostedScan Security provides a comprehensive set Continuing on from my original metasploit beginners tutorial, here is a slightly more advanced Metasploit tutorial on how to use metasploit to scan for vulnerabilities. It also This Nmap tutorial will explain how to use this free tool to identify devices, as well as detect possible network vulnerabilities and infections. To completely examine and fix vulnerabilities, security professionals should combine specialized vulnerability scanning Run the following nmap scan against a single instance of mssql server (e. 100 A recently disclosed critical vulnerability in MySQL authentication on some platforms gave me just the excuse I needed to write my first Nmap NSE script. Run a TLS scan to verify that your website certificate is valid and correctly set up for secure https traffic. Identifying devices on the network. 231. CLICK TLDR; While both Nmap and MSF scripts can be used for network reconnaissance and vulnerability scanning, the primary difference lies in their intended use. If its vulnerable, it will also attempt todump the MySQL usernames and password hashes. Identifying and mitigating SQL injection vulnerabilities is crucial for securing web applications. Nmap, or network mapper, is an open-source program for scanning and finding network vulnerabilities. Initial Network Mapping ## Discover live hosts nmap -sn 192. In In this blog post, I’ll walk you through the process I followed to scan and identify open ports and services on a Metasploitable2 machine, including the vulnerabilities associated with each service. While most security practitioners are familiar with basic to Detection of Heartbleed through the use of Nmap. Attempts to detect if a Microsoft SMBv1 server is vulnerable to a remote code execution vulnerability (ms17-010, a. Reply reply Sittadel • This guy gets it. SQL Server 2019): sudo nmap -sS -p 1433 --script ms-sql-info -sV 127. 1. It also extracts forms from found websites and tries to identify fields that are vulnerable. 0/24. Stack Exchange network consists of 183 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Practical Vulnerability Scanning ## Comprehensive vulnerability scan nmap -sV --script vuln 192. FREE Career Guide; Certification Matchmaker; Career Matchmaker; Cyber Security Certificate Landscape; Cyber Career Pathway; Cyber Run a web app scan to test your website code for misconfigured cookies, SQL injection vulnerabilities, cross-site scripting vulnerabilities, and more. nse. : nmap -sn --script ms-sql-empty-password --script-args mssql. 5. The nmap option -sV enables version detection per service which is used to determine potential flaws according to To perform a vulnerability scan, Nmap employs a collection of NSE scripts tailored to check for known vulnerabilities in common network services such as HTTP, FTP, and SSH. The vulnerability is actively exploited by Practical Vulnerability Scanning ## Comprehensive vulnerability scan nmap -sV --script vuln 192. 2. 0. 4, it may be possible that the system is vulnerable to CVE-2012-1823 and CVE-2012-2311 which affected PHP before 5. Nmap has expanded past being just a port scanner, and now you can use it as a vulnerability scanner as well. Its scripting engine allows users to develop custom scripts to identify vulnerabilities in networked systems. Reply reply [deleted] • Comment deleted by user. One popular script is called NMAP has NSE Script for http SQL injection vulnerabilities and scans the web application for SQL injection. nmap -sp 192. Let's scan hosts. Nmap has a built-in toolbox called NSE (Nmap Scripting Engine) that can scan for vulnerabilities using pre-written scripts. @jcran produced a metasploit module to find and exploit the MySQL bug so I thought I’d try and fill a gap in the Nmap world. Network Vulnerability Scanner. The nmap option -sV enables version detection per service which is used to determine potential flaws according to the identified product. Scanning using hex flag values allows you to set special conditions for scanning packets. Since both internal security teams and In this article we’ll cover port 3306 which is MySQL default port. The most famous type of scan is the Nmap ping scan (so-called because it’s often used to perform Nmap ping sweeps), and it’s the easiest way to detect hosts on any network. 109 How to use the vulners NSE script: examples, script-args, and references. All MariaDB a Connects to a MySQL server and prints information such as the protocol and version numbers, thread ID, status, capabilities, and the password salt. Expected behavior Expecting the full NSE script output for ms-sql-info: Nmap script that scans for probable vulnerabilities based on services discovered in open ports. In this article, we are discussing MYSQL penetration testing using Nmap where you will learn how to retrieve Nmap-vulners. SQL Server credentials required: No (will not benefit from mssql Nmap is not strictly a vulnerability scanner but a robust network exploration tool that can also perform security scanning. Nmap has a graphical user interface called Zenmap. The [] During security auditing and vulnerability scanning, you can use Nmap to attack systems using existing scripts from the Nmap Scripting Engine. Understanding the Nmap Scan Results. TCP Scan/TCP Connect Scan: nmap -sT 192. Blank passwords can be checked using the ms-sql-empty-password script. The downsides are that it currently only supports the MySQL database and it must be frequently ported to new Nmap versions. If your VPS is configured for IPv6, please remember to secure both your IPv4 and IPv6 network interfaces with the appropriate tools. 100 Security Assessment Workflow 1. Nmap Ping Scan. It's a Swiss Army Knife. 168. Nmap scripts are designed to provide A nmap script scan shows the information below. In Linux, IPv6 security is maintained separately from IPv4. nmap. Go to your Nmap (either Windows/Linux) and fire the command: nmap 192. 1 Wait for the Nmap scan to complete. This information can then be used to prioritize and I’m writing this topic at first to learn the Web pentesting in deep and the second one for the pleasure to hack ;) So today I’m going to explain this challenge. Redacted This post was mass deleted and anonymized with Redact. The nmap option -sV enables version detection per service which is used to determine potential flaws according to Nmap Explained: A Complete Guide to Network Scanning & Security"In this video, we dive into the world of Nmap (Network Mapper), a powerful open-source tool u How to use the mysql-databases NSE script: examples, script-args, and references. You can replace [IP address range] with the IP address range for the network you want to scan. It is also a specialized script whereby NMAP can scan a purpose device to check whether it's susceptible to the Heartbleed trojan horse. Reply reply charlesxavier007 • • Edited . I didn’t have anything in my VM This type of web vulnerability is widespread, and because each script variable must be tested, checking for such vulnerabilities can be a very tedious task. Link below. Nmap Scans using Hex Value of Flags . Once we are able to find the open ports and the corresponding services running on them, we can carry on our scan to look for detailed version numbers on every service running on each port so that we can then try different auxiliary modules on Metasploit to find possible exploits. Pentesters and other security experts use Nmap to find devices In the event of a vulnerability being discovered targeting this version of MySQL, an attacker could quickly use it to compromise your server. Courses; Blog; Resources Menu Toggle. And to create a user defined you will need a library for the OS that is running mysql. This is the second edition of ‘Nmap 6: Network Exploration and Security Auditing Cookbook’. A book aimed for anyone who wants to master Nmap and its scripting engine through practical tasks for system administrators and penetration testers. Security Concerns: While Nmap is a legitimate tool, it can be misused by attackers for unauthorized activities such as network reconnaissance, port In this video, I demonstrate how to perform MySQL enumeration with Nmap. 100 ## Specific vulnerability category nmap --script default,safe 192. It This Bash script runs all respective Nmap (. Nikto. HostedScan's Wordpress Scan Service. 0/24 ## Detailed service identification nmap -sV -p- 192. Still, it would be quite unfair to reduce Nmap to nothing more than a “network mapper” or “port scanner. 4. Let’s see 2 popular scanning techniques which can be commonly used for services enumeration and vulnerability assessment. It can also perform subdomain enumeration to a local brute = require "brute" local creds = require "creds" local mysql = require "mysql" local nmap = require "nmap" local shortport = require "shortport" local stdnse = require "stdnse" local string = require "string" local openssl = stdnse. security hack nmap penetration-testing metasploit-framework vulnerability-detection hacking-tool vulnerability-scanners metasploit nmap-scripts ceh metasploit-automation nmap-scan metasploit-install mapsploit Updated Nov 2, 2023; Shell; Attempts to determine configuration and version information for Microsoft SQL Server instances. Nmap scan mostly used for ports scanning, OS detection, detection of used software version and in some other cases for example like vulnerability scanning. One of the most well-known vulnerability scanners is Nmap-vulners. Introduction. The existence of potential flaws is not verified with additional scanning nor exploiting techniques. instance-all <host> The script uses two means of getting version information for SQL Server instances: Vulnerability Assessment Menu Toggle. In this lab, you will learn how to use Nmap and Metasploit for network scanning and vulnerability analysis. It has two very popular types of scripts called vulners and vulscan, which can be used along with its commands to One of the first tasks I took on was performing a basic vulnerability scan using Nmap, a powerful network scanning tool that helps identify live hosts and potential weaknesses in a network. 3. It is widely used for managing and organizing data in a structured format, using tables to Closed/Filtered: This indicates that the port was filtered or closed but Nmap couldn't establish the state. CLICK HERE. Basic Syntax: The basic syntax for running a It Nmap scan is: nmap [Scan Type] [Options] {Target} Scan Type: Specifies the type of scan (e. Reply reply me_z • Yeah, but then you have to use Nessus. Nmap is used to discover hosts and services on a computer network by sending packets The PHP info information disclosure vulnerability provides internal system information and service version information that can be used to look up vulnerabilities. Nmap Scanning Techniques 1. org/nmap/scripts/http-sql-injection. o Introduction. SQL injection is a common web application vulnerability that allows attackers to interfere with the queries that an application makes to its database. Vulnerability Scanning with Nmap Scripts. Nmap (Network Mapper) is a powerful open-source utility for network discovery and security auditing, while Metasploit is a widely used penetration testing framework that includes a variety of exploitation tools and payloads. Scanning for vulnerabilities with Nmap and Metasploit. @jcran A collection of nmap vulnerability scanning scripts to aid afforable detection and remediation. This recipe shows how to find SQL injection vulnerabilities in web applications with The -sS option tells NMAP to perform a TCP SYN scan. Vulscan is a module which enhances nmap to a vulnerability scanner. An XML-based approach, on the other hand, is less likely to break when new Nmap vulnerability scan. Scan a single network. a. The library vuln manages and unifies the output of the vulnerability - Selection from Nmap 6: Network Exploration and Security Auditing Cookbook [Book] As a seasoned penetration tester, Nmap (Network Mapper) is one of my go-to tools for network exploration and vulnerability discovery.